I understand your HP DeskJet 4120e All-in-One Printer is having trouble completing the setup, here are several steps you can follow to resolve the issue:
1. Check Printer's Wireless Connection
- Ensure printer is in setup mode: If you're setting it up for the first time, the printer should automatically be in setup mode (indicated by a blinking blue wireless light). If it's not, restore setup mode by pressing and holding the Wireless and Cancel buttons on the printer for 5 seconds until the light starts blinking.
- Bring the printer close to the router: Ensure the printer is within range of your WiFi router.
2. Use the HP Smart App for Setup
- Make sure the HP Smart app is installed on your device (available for Windows, macOS, Android, and iOS).
- Open the HP Smart app and add the printer. The app will guide you through the setup process.
3. Restart Printer and Devices
- Power cycle the printer by turning it off, unplugging it for a minute, and then plugging it back in.
- Restart your computer or mobile device.
4. Ensure Internet Connection is Stable
- Verify that your WiFi network is working properly by testing other devices.
- Turn off mobile data if setting up via a mobile device to ensure it connects through WiFi only.
5. Disable VPN or Firewall Temporarily
- Turn off VPN if it's active during the setup process as it can interfere with communication between the printer and the network.
- Temporarily disable firewall settings on your device to allow smooth communication during setup.
6. Update Printer Firmware Update the firmware on an HP printer
- If possible, connect the printer via USB to a PC and update its firmware using the HP Smart app or the HP website to ensure the latest version is installed.
7. Use an Alternate Setup Method
- If the wireless setup continues to fail, try setting up the printer using a USB connection to ensure the initial configuration goes through, and then switch to wireless afterward.
